Average Pressers, Textile, Garment, and Related Materials Salary in Binghamton, NY

The average salary for a Pressers, Textile, Garment, and Related Materials in Binghamton, NY is $32,250. This compensation is in line with national standards, reflecting a balanced and stable local job market. Notably, Binghamton, NY is a key hub for this profession, with a job concentration 2.83x higher than average.
